Gastric outlet obstruction caused by a giant gastroduodenal artery aneurysm: a case report.

Z Androulakakis1, G Paspatis, A Hatzidakis, M Kokkinaki, N Papanicolaou, I Grammatikakis, D Liapi, S Kandylakis.   

Abstract

Gastric outlet (GO) obstruction in an adult is usually caused by intrinsic gastric or duodenal lesions or pancreatic tumours. This study describes a case of a 77-year-old man who developed GO obstruction due to extrinsic compression from a large gastroduodenal artery aneurysm under rupture. This cause of GO obstruction has never previously been reported in the literature.
